Mill Lane is in Alfington, Ottery St. Mary and in East Devon district. EX11 1PF is located in the Ottery St Mary elect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of East Devon.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

Partnership Status

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.

In the immediate vicinity of EX11 1PF there is a very large concentration of residents that are married - 60.1% of the resident population. In contrast, the average marriage rate across the census is about 44%.

Areas with a high percentage of married residents are typically suburban neighborhoods, towns with good schools and family-friendly amenities, and regions with affordable, spacious housing options. Additionally, such areas can be popular among retirees.

Safety

Is Mill Lane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Mill Lane was 24.4 per 1,000 residents, which is 60.2% lower than the Cranbrook average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Mill Lane has the 21st lowest crime rate of 41 local areas in Cranbrook and the 175th lowest crime rate of 480 local areas in East Devon .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 8.1 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-38.5%.

Employment

EX11 1PF area has a very high level of entrepreneurship. Only 2% of streets have higher percent of entrepreneur residents. 20% of population in this area is self-employed, while the average in the UK is 9.7%. High number of entrepreneurs usually leads to relatively high economic growth, higher paid jobs and better quality of life in the area.

EX11 1PF area has a low unemployment rate. According to Census 2021, 1% residents of this area were unemployed, while the average in the UK was 4.83%. A low level of unemployment in an area indicates a strong job market, where most people who are seeking work can find employment. This generally reflects a healthy economy in the area.
